Nicaragua NI: Coverage: Social Safety Net Programs: Richest Quintile: % of Population data was reported at 37.130 % in 2014. This records an increase from the previous number of 23.364 % for 2009. Nicaragua NI: Coverage: Social Safety Net Programs: Richest Quintile: % of Population data is updated yearly, averaging 25.133 % from Dec 2005 (Median) to 2014, with 3 observations. The data reached an all-time high of 37.130 % in 2014 and a record low of 23.364 % in 2009. Coverage of social safety net programs shows the percentage of population participating in cash transfers and last resort programs, noncontributory social pensions, other cash transfers programs (child, family and orphan allowances, birth and death grants, disability benefits, and other allowances), conditional cash transfers, in-kind food transfers (food stamps and vouchers, food rations, supplementary feeding, and emergency food distribution), school feeding, other social assistance programs (housing allowances, scholarships, fee waivers, health subsidies, and other social assistance) and public works programs (cash for work and food for work). Estimates include both direct and indirect beneficiaries.; ; ASPIRE: The Atlas of Social Protection - Indicators of Resilience and Equity, The World Bank. Data are based on national representative household surveys. (datatopics.worldbank.org/aspire/); Simple average;
